Grass is one of the trickier stains to tackle. A grass stain usually appears after vigorous activity, such as sliding, kneeling or any way grass could be rubbed into the fabric. Below are ways to remove grass stains from various materials.
Removing Grass Stains From Denim
While denim is a hearty fabric, it can also make it difficult for stain removal. Wet the spot thoroughly to soften up the denim. Apply a small amount of detergent or spot treater. If you feel the stain is extra set in you can scrub it with a toothbrush or soft-bristled scrub brush. Then wash your jeans according to the tag instructions. If the stain isn’t completely removed repeat all of the steps. Hang to dry.
Removing Grass Stains From Cotton
Cotton is used in a lot of everyday clothing items. To remove a stain from cotton start by soaking the spot in warm water. Then apply a spot treatment such as Biz. Gently dab the stain with a clean cloth. Wash the garments with an enzyme detergent such as Biz Powder. Enzymes are great at breaking down organic stains such as grass. Repeat steps until the stain is gone then dry according to garment instructions.
Removing Grass Stains From Sneakers
While white shoes are great for a summer look, they sure get dirty fast. To tackle stains on sneakers start by wiping down the shoe with a damp cloth to remove as much as possible. Mix 1 part Biz Stain & Odor Eliminator with 3 parts water and apply to shoes. Gently scrub with a soft-bristled brush like a toothbrush. Gently wipe with a clean damp towel and air dry.
Removing Grass Stains From Athletic Pants
Stains on athletic apparel are time-sensitive due to being made from synthetic materials. It can be a little more difficult to remove stains from polyester. Soak the stain and scrub in a little bit of Biz Stain & Odor eliminator and let sit. Scrub with a toothbrush on both sides of the fabric till the stain is gone. Rinse with warm water and let air dry.
